I applied online. I interviewed at Sabre (Dallas, TX) in Jun 2016
Interview
I read the job description on LinkedIn and applied on Sabre's website. I was invited for an on-site interview directly. I requested a phone screening first, but they insisted on the plan. Anyways, C++, the language of choice there, was not listed in my resume but instead I had Java. I was familiar with most of the numeric optimization methods they utilized, and I was asked about them. I stated I wasn't exposed to RM, but I was asked an RM question.
Finally, I received a call a week after the interview with the excuse that the company wanted to move forward with a candidate with more coding skills. I was not even asked a coding question during the entire interview :)
